kopia lustrzana https://github.com/espressif/esp-idf
22b840f3df
When CONFIG_ESP32_RTCDATA_IN_FAST_MEM is enabled, RTC data is placed into RTC_FAST memory region, viewed from the data bus. However the bootloader was missing a check that this region should not be overwritten after deep sleep, which caused .rtc.bss segment to loose its contents after wakeup. |
||
---|---|---|
.. | ||
include/soc | ||
test | ||
component.mk | ||
cpu_util.c | ||
gpio_periph.c | ||
i2c_apll.h | ||
i2c_bbpll.h | ||
i2c_rtc_clk.h | ||
rtc_clk.c | ||
rtc_clk_common.h | ||
rtc_clk_init.c | ||
rtc_init.c | ||
rtc_periph.c | ||
rtc_pm.c | ||
rtc_sleep.c | ||
rtc_time.c | ||
rtc_wdt.c | ||
sdio_slave_periph.c | ||
sdmmc_periph.c | ||
soc_log.h | ||
soc_memory_layout.c | ||
sources.cmake | ||
spi_periph.c |